Weather: Stay tuned to local radio and TV stations, The Weather Channel, or Weather website http://www.weather.com/ Purchase a NOAA weather radio with battery/self-generating option. Newer models come with "SAME technology" that tunes into the National Emergency Alert System and picks up on emergencies specific to the local geographic area. National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ration: http://www.noaa.gov/ Weatherwatch: http://www.noaawatch.gov/

This section is meant to supplement information provided through official emergency communications sources. The front section of the local and county phone books contains phone numbers and information on emergency preparedness and planning for disasters. Residents are advised to consult it in addition to this list. Residents are urged to develop an individual emergency plan, to keep smoke detectors and lightning mitigation systems operational, and to purchase a NOAA weather radio that has battery/self- generating option and SAME technology that tunes in to the national Emergency Alert System (EAS) and broadcasts local and pertinent emergency information. |
